About CO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L

Located at 12092 W. STATE HIGHWAY 22, in BRANCH, Arkansas, CO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L is a tight-knit senior high that works with 229 students (grades 7 through 12), part of COUNTY LINE SCHOOL DISTRICT. Compared to the state average of about 510 students per school, that is 55% below typical.

Across the 2 schools in COUNTY LINE SCHOOL DISTRICT (556 students total), CO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L accounts for its share of the district's footprint.

For racial and ethnic makeup, CO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L shows that the student body is overwhelmingly White (91%). The remainder breaks down as 3% Asian, 3% Native American. That composition is broadly in line with Logan County as a whole.

Looking at school resources, CO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L logs 42 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 5.4: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 8.8:1, putting CO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L tighter than the state norm the norm. About 99%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ment. That share is higher than Logan County's rate of about 90%.

After controlling for student poverty, CO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L performs roughly as the BeatsExpectations model predicts for a school with this FRL share. The predicted value is around 22.8%, the actual is 35.5%, a residual of +12.7 points.

Zooming out to the county, census data for Logan County shows the typical household earns roughly $58,555 per year, 17%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 8%. In all, Logan County runs 11 public schools (combined enrollment of about 3,557 students), of which CO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L is one.

COUNTY LINE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.1 miles from this campus. Within ten miles, there are 3 other public schools, a sparser pattern than typical urban areas. On composite proficiency, CO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L comes 6th of 9 in the immediate cluster, behind the nearby-schools average of 37.6%.

CO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L operates from a low-density location.

Over the past 7-year window.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at COUNTY LINE HIGH SCHOOL has edged up 7%, going from 214 students in 2018 to 229 in 2025. The student-to-teacher ratio fell from 12.2:1 in 2018 to 5.4:1 today.
